How cold is too cold for a car battery?

Typically a fully charged battery will not freeze until -76°F. A fully discharged battery could start to freeze around 32°F, though, so give it some juice if your car is hesitating to turn over.22 sept 2016

Can cold weather mess with a car battery?

Cold weather slows everything down, especially the chemical reaction happening inside your car battery. In fact, at 32°F, a car's battery loses about 35% of its strength. And at 0°F, it loses up to 60% of its strength—but your engine requires nearly twice as much power to start!19 nov 2018

What is the purpose of a car battery cover?

The jacket helps the battery retain heat in the winter and repel engine compartment heat in the summer. Removing the battery insulating jacket can shorten the life of the battery by almost two-thirds, especially if you live in a hot climate.15 mar 2018

How long can a car battery sit in cold weather?

At colder temperatures, the battery's ability to provide sufficient power to start and run a vehicle is diminished. Automotive batteries are rated in CCA (Cold-Cranking Amperage). This is the amount of current a battery can deliver for 30 seconds at -18 C without dropping to a specified cut-off voltage.

Does putting a blanket over engine help?

A-The blanket may protect the engine from wind, but it really has little effect on starting the car. That`s because, technically, wind chill has no effect on the engine. Cold temperatures will, of course, cause the engine oil to become thicker, making the motor turn over slower.12 mar 1989
